massonianoside b

Massonianoside B is an antioxidant, which can be isolated from Cedrus deodara pine needle. Massonianoside B exhibits radicals scavenging capacities, and restores CCL4-impaired activity of antioxidant enzymes[1].

  • CAS Number: 188300-19-8
  • MF: C25H32O10
  • MW: 492.52
  • Catalog: Inflammation/Immunology
  • Density: 1.4±0.1 g/cm3
  • Boiling Point: 708.9±60.0 °C at 760 mmHg
  • Melting Point: N/A
  • Flash Point: 382.6±32.9 °C

Metaxalone

Metaxalone(AHR438;NSC170959) is a muscle relaxant used to relax muscles.Target: OthersMetaxalone is a muscle relaxant used to relax muscles and relieve pain caused by strains, sprains, and other musculoskeletal conditions. Its exact mechanism of action is not known, but it may be due to general central nervous system depression. It is considered to be a moderately strong muscle relaxant, with relatively low incidence of side effects.

  • CAS Number: 1665-48-1
  • MF: C12H15NO3
  • MW: 221.252
  • Catalog: Neurological Disease
  • Density: 1.1±0.1 g/cm3
  • Boiling Point: 453.6±14.0 °C at 760 mmHg
  • Melting Point: 121-123ºC
  • Flash Point: 228.2±20.1 °C

Benzyl cinnamate

Benzyl cinnamate, occurs in Balsam of Peru and Tolu balsam, in Sumatra and Penang benzoin, and as the main constituent of copaiba balsam, is used in heavy oriental perfumes and as a fixative[1].

  • CAS Number: 103-41-3
  • MF: C16H14O2
  • MW: 238.281
  • Catalog: Others
  • Density: 1.1±0.1 g/cm3
  • Boiling Point: 195-200 ºC (5 mmHg)
  • Melting Point: 34-37 °C(lit.)
  • Flash Point: 225.7±10.4 °C

4',6-Diamidino-2-phenylindole dihydrochloride

DAPI dihydrochloride (4',6-diamidino-2-phenylindole) is a fluorescent stain by binding in the minor grove of A-T rich sequences of DNA.

  • CAS Number: 28718-90-3
  • MF: C16H17Cl2N5
  • MW: 350.246
  • Catalog: Dye Reagents
  • Density: 1.41g/cm3
  • Boiling Point: 545.4ºC at 760mmHg
  • Melting Point: >300°C (dec.)
  • Flash Point: 283.6ºC

Monomethyl auristatin E intermediate-9

Monomethyl auristatin E intermediate-9 is an intermediate reagent in the synthesis of Monomethyl auristatin E (HY-15162). Monomethyl auristatin E (MMAE) is a microtubule/tubulin inhibitor with anticancer activity. MMAE is widely used as the cytotoxic component (ADC Cytotoxin) of antibody-drug conjugates (ADCs)[1].

  • CAS Number: 120205-58-5
  • MF: C22H35NO5
  • MW: 393.52
  • Catalog: Cancer
  • Density: N/A
  • Boiling Point: N/A
  • Melting Point: N/A
  • Flash Point: N/A
